June 12, 1949 - November 27, 2021
 
Ava Maria Caza passed away peacefully on Saturday November 27, 2021 in Kitchener after a brief illness.
 
Ava was born on June 12, 1949 in Halifax, NS. Throughout her life, Ava was many things including a laboratory technician, a loving mother, a loyal friend, and a dedicated partner. Perhaps one of her most cherished roles was that as mother to Arran and Gregory and grandmother to Max, Alex, and Vivienne, all of whom inherited her charm, wry wit, compassion for animals, stubbornness, and levelling glare. Ava loved long walks in nature, suspense novels, board games, and a great cup of tea. She was a stellar conversationalist and will be remembered for her energetic spirit, curiosity, kindness, and sense of humour.  Ava will be deeply missed by many.
 
She is survived by her partner since 2005 Brian Brocklebank, her sons and grandchildren, daughter-in-law Brianna Caza, sisters Linda (Eric) and Susan (Sylvain), in-laws Audrey, Claudia, Antoinette, and Jolene (Howard), and Garth (Amelia) and nineteen surviving nephews and nieces.
 
Ava was predeceased by her husband Bryan Caza, as well as her parents Kenneth and Oriola Golar, sisters Fern and Irma, nephew Bob, and in-laws Melvin (Marguerite), Tony, and Vance.
 
The family wishes to thank the staff at Innisfree House for keeping her comfortable in her final days.
 
Per her wishes, she has been cremated and there will be a celebration of life service held at a later date.
 
In lieu of flowers, charitable donations in Ava’s memory can be made to any cancer charity or local SPCA organization.
